Understanding Depression and Its Impact
Depression is a complex mental health disorder that significantly impacts an individual’s daily life and overall well-being. It is characterized by persistent feelings of sadness, loss of interest in activities once enjoyed, changes in appetite and sleep patterns, fatigue, difficulty concentrating, and in severe cases, thoughts of suicide or self-harm. This common yet debilitating condition affects millions of people worldwide, including many residents in Scottsdale, AZ, and its surrounding areas like Mesa.
Understanding depression is the first step towards recovery. Many individuals struggle with depressive symptoms for various reasons, such as genetic predisposition, traumatic life events, chronic illnesses, or environmental factors.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T): A Step-by-Step Guide
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) is a structured and goal-oriented approach to depression counseling in Scottsdale, AZ. It focuses on identifying and changing negative thought patterns and behaviors that contribute to depressive symptoms. The process begins with evaluating your current thoughts, feelings, and behaviors to pinpoint problematic areas. Once these are identified, the therapist will work with you to challenge and replace irrational beliefs with more realistic and positive ones.
CBT involves a series of steps: understanding your depression, learning coping strategies, applying new skills in real-life situations, and maintaining progress over time. Through this evidence-based therapy, individuals gain valuable tools to manage their depression effectively. Mindfulness Practices for Managing Depressive Symptoms
Mindfulness practices have emerged as a powerful tool within the realm of depression counseling in Scottsdale, AZ. These techniques, often incorporated into c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T), encourage individuals to focus on the present moment, cultivating awareness of their thoughts and emotions without judgment. By embracing mindfulness, clients can develop a deeper understanding of their depressive patterns, allowing them to respond rather than react impulsively. This proactive approach enables individuals to navigate through challenging feelings with greater equanimity, fostering resilience against depression’s relentless grip.
In the context of therapy for depression in Scottsdale, mindfulness goes beyond mere meditation. It’s an expansive practice that includes body scans, mindful breathing exercises, and even everyday activities like walking or eating mindfully.
